The Role Technology Plays In Florida’s Hurricane Season
Florida Emergency Management has been scrambling to improve their severe weather alert systems ahead of hurricane season, pouring 12 million dollars into a 40 month project. And there's still a long way to go.

Hurricane Evacuation On Florida’s Highways Under Construction
Florida’s population along the coast has boomed in the eleven years since the last hurricane hit. That combined with miles of construction on major highways could make evacuating ahead of a storm an even bigger headache this hurricane season.
